The 210,000 square foot of gaming space is situated on two levels and is home to more than 2,8oo slot machines, 166 table games, including private gambling salons and high-limit gaming rooms, and a 24-hour 74-table poker room, with 11 high-limit tables, six separate VIP tables, dedicated grill, 24-hour daily cash games and more! outdoor waterfront event lawn, picnic and public viewing areas and retail and dining experiences that overlook the water. grand ballroom with unobstructed views and the six-acre Encore Harborwalk, which features a 21,000 sq. of divisible meeting space featuring a 37,000 sq. Other amenities include 10,000 sq ft of luxury retail shops, 50,000 sq. It is the largest private development ever in the state and includes 15 casual and high-end dining and lounge venues, including a gaming floor Cantina for budget-minded gamblers, along with a boutique nightclub, a five-star 26,000 sq ft spa with 17 treatment rooms. Stunning inside and out, the property features art from around the world, including the famous 2,000-pound "Popeye" statue by famous artist Jeff Koons that was purchased at a Sotheby's auction by Wynn Resorts founder Steve Wynn for $28 million, while guests share thier rooms with notable Roy Lichtenstein works. Other key amenities include upscale bathrooms featuring separate showers and deep-soaking tubs, dual sinks, a seated vanity area with lighted mirror, and a 24-inch flat-screen HDTV. Guests enjoy luxury bed linens and skyline views via floor-to-ceiling windows. There are also 3,350-square-foot two-bedroom residences and two 5,800-square-foot villas. The five-star luxury resort opened on Sunday, June 23, 2019, and features a 27-story tower showcasing 671 guest rooms and suites with a variety of floor plans to suit your needs, from the smallest at 650 square feet to 1,350 square feet suites. Located in Everett, Massachusetts on the historic Mystic River waterfront, the $2.6 billion Encore Boston Harbor is just minutes from Logan International Airport. (1) The psychiatric unit in a hospital is not a legal entity but is part of the hospital (the "parent"), which is a legal entity. Here are three examples of organization health care providers that may be considered subparts and may apply for NPIs if so directed by their "parents": Many organization health care providers who apply for NPIs are not legal entities themselves but are parts of other organization health care providers that are legal entities (the "parents"). The Parent Organization LBN and TIN fields can only be completed if the answer to the subpart question is Yes. If the organization is a subpart =, the Parent Organization Legal Business Name (LBN) and Parent Organization Taxpayer Identification Number (TIN) fields must be completed.
